[firebase-br] Trigger After Delete no Detail - Ajuda !!!

Gill Mayeron gill em valim.com.br
Ter Out 19 13:50:26 -03 2004


Execute Trigger não tem jeito, mas vc pode criar uma Procedure e executá-la
dentro da trigger passando os parâmetros que forem necessários (EXECUTE
PROCEDURE ...).



----- Original Message -----
From: "Marcilio Soares" <marcilio.soares em brfree.com.br>
To: "FireBase" <lista em firebase.com.br>
Sent: Tuesday, October 19, 2004 3:12 PM
Subject: Re: [firebase-br] Trigger After Delete no Detail - Ajuda !!!


> e isso que tava pensando mas to ferrado pq preciso que a trigger do detail
> faz extorno de estoque.
> Tem como dar um EXECUTE TRIGGER bla bla bla . Sera?
>
> ----- Original Message -----
> From: "Gill Mayeron" <gill em valim.com.br>
> To: "FireBase" <lista em firebase.com.br>
> Sent: Tuesday, October 19, 2004 11:33 AM
> Subject: Re: [firebase-br] Trigger After Delete no Detail - Ajuda !!!
>
>
> > Tive o mesmo problema a alguns dias.
> >
> > Também deduzi que o master está sendo excluído primeiro, por isso
inverti
> o
> > processo:
> >
> > Criei todo processo que eu queria (no meu caso era a gravação do log) na
> > Trigger da Tabela Master, no evento After Delete.
> >
> > Desta maneira funcionou corretamente.
> >
> >
> > ----- Original Message -----
> > From: "Marcilio Soares" <marcilio.soares em brfree.com.br>
> > To: "FireBase-Forum" <lista em firebase.com.br>
> > Sent: Tuesday, October 19, 2004 12:40 PM
> > Subject: [firebase-br] Trigger After Delete no Detail - Ajuda !!!
> >
> >
> > > Tenho Tabela Master e a Detail com Cascade para Delete.
> > >
> > >  Ha uma trigger After Delete no Detail que faz assim:
> > >  SELECT AREA FROM MASTER WHERE PK=DETAIL.FK INTO :AREA
> > >
> > >  Quando deleto registro no detail  a trigger pega o valor :AREA
certinho
> e
> > >  faz o que tem que fazer mas quando deleto o Master que esta com
Cascade
> > > para
> > >  delete o valor de :AREA e "0", pq ?
> > >
> > >  Pelo que to entendendo ele ta deletando o Master primeiro e
disparando
> a
> > >  trigger no detail depois. e isso ? ou to fazendo alguma coisa errada.
> > >  Ja tentei usar BEFORE na trigger do detail mas tb nao deu.
> > >
> > >  Alguem da uma luz? Pq eu nao quero fazer truques pra resolver isso !
> > >
> > >
> > >
> > >
> > > ______________________________________________
> > > FireBase-BR (www.firebase.com.br)
> > > Para editar sua configuração na lista, use o endereço
> > http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
> > >
> >
> >
> > ______________________________________________
> > FireBase-BR (www.firebase.com.br)
> > Para editar sua configuração na lista, use o endereço
> http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
> >
> >
>
>
>
> ______________________________________________
> FireBase-BR (www.firebase.com.br)
> Para editar sua configuração na lista, use o endereço
http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
>





Mais detalhes sobre a lista de discussão lista